    Depends on location. In a club I dislike taking requests, I am a DJ not a beatbox and I play for all people not only for the one that comes and asks and many requests are ridiculous.
    On a wedding (or similar events), I sure take requests, especially from the bride or groom. It is their “happy day” so of course they deserve the music they want to hear, but then usually you get a list of songs they love beforehand and it is quite rare that I get requests during the set.
